Common Crawlspace Foundation Repair Jobs
Crawlspace foundation repair involves fixing issues that compromise the stability and safety of a home's foundation.
Vapor barrier installation helps prevent moisture buildup and reduces mold growth in crawlspaces.
Post and pier stabilization addresses uneven or sinking crawlspace floors for improved structural integrity.
Sagging or damaged beams are reinforced or replaced to support the home’s weight properly.
Moisture control solutions reduce humidity levels and protect the foundation from water damage.
Structural reinforcement strengthens weak or compromised crawlspace supports to ensure long-term stability.
Crawlspace Foundation Repair Questions
What are signs of crawlspace foundation issues? Indicators include uneven floors, cracks in walls or ceilings, and musty odors in the home.
Why is it important to repair a crawlspace foundation? Repairing prevents further damage, improves home stability, and reduces issues like mold and pests.
What types of repairs are common for crawlspace foundations? Common repairs include underpinning, pier installation, and sealing to stabilize and protect the foundation.
How can I tell if my crawlspace needs repair? Visible cracks, sagging floors, or persistent moisture problems are signs that professional assessment may be needed.
